Abstract

The invention relates to the field of copper industry machining, in particular to high-precision type casting equipment for the copper industry machining. According to the high-precision type castingequipment for the copper industry machining, the casting efficiency is high, the casting product quality is high, the labor intensity is low, the safety is high, and steel material quantity supply isaccurate. The high-precision type casting equipment for the copper industry machining comprises a placing seat, a casting device, a first supporting column, a first motor, a first gear, a first rotating shaft, a second gear, a first bearing block, a discharging hopper, a material receiving frame, a second rotating shaft, a second bearing block, a second supporting column, a discharging frame, an electric discharging valve, a first elastic part, a guiding rod, a lifting rod, a sliding plate, first mixing rods and the like. Description

Technical field [0001] The invention relates to the field of copper industry processing, in particular to a high-precision casting equipment for copper industry processing. Background technique [0002] Steel is a general term for iron-carbon alloys with carbon content between 0.02% and 2.11% by mass. The chemical composition of steel can vary greatly. Steel containing only carbon elements is called carbon steel (carbon steel) or ordinary steel; in actual production, steel often contains different alloying elements, such as manganese, Nickel, vanadium, etc. Mankind has a long history of application and research on steel, but until the invention of Bayesian steelmaking in the 19th century, steel production was a high-cost and low-efficiency work. Nowadays, steel has become one of the most used materials in the world due to its low price and reliable performance.
